The venue prides itself on blending old and new, with the grand Victorian building having been brought right up to date with thoughtful additions that couples love. Take the brand-new powder room (shown below left), for example: located just across the hall from the ballroom and exclusive to wedding couples, it’s the perfect refuge for the newlyweds to steal a moment away from the crowd – or for emergency lipstick touch-ups or blister plaster applications.

The recently renovated ballroom (pictured above right) can sit 170 of your guests for dinner, with a further thirty able to join for the evening reception. Couples also have exclusive-use of the Champagne Bar and conservatory on their wedding day, so you and your loved ones can really feel like lords and ladies of the manor.
